We’ve Crushed the Pool!

Our Crush the Pool Party on June 27 marked the end of an era—and the beginning of an exciting new chapter at Loyola Academy—as nearly 250 aquatic program alumni, coaches, pool benefactors, parents and friends gathered to celebrate the O’Shaughnessy Pool’s illustrious past, kick off the demolition of our 1950s-era natatorium and see what the future holds for Loyola aquatics.
“I am filled with gratitude to be here with all of you tonight,” commented Loyola Academy Executive Vice President and former Head Swimming and Diving Coach Dennis R. Stonequist ’90 as he surveyed the crowd, which included Rambler swimmers, divers and water polo players dating back to the 1960s, as well as members of the Baker family, which has been involved in Loyola aquatics since 1946. “Over the years, our aquatics program has been about commitment, about family and about friendships. Our new John D. Norcross ’54 Aquatic Center will carry those traditions into the next 60 years and beyond.”
 
After sharing food, drinks and memories about Loyola’s long tradition of excellence in aquatics, the guests gathered to watch the south wall of the old natatorium come down as the demolition began (see story at left). “As we stand here tonight, stepping up to say yes to what God is inviting us to dream, our campus is undergoing a renaissance,” reflected Loyola Academy President Rev. Patrick E. McGrath, SJ, before the demolition countdown commenced. “Thank you all for making this renaissance possible. Now, the moment you’ve all been waiting for: the drama of punching a hole in the Ignatius A. O’Shaughnessy swimming pool!”

Norcross Aquatic Center Project Timeline 

JUNE–JULY 2018
Demolition of the old O’Shaughnessy Pool and natatorium is completed.

AUGUST 2018
Excavation for the new natatorium foundation and pool is completed.

SEPTEMBER 2018
The concrete shell of the pool and the building foundation are poured; piping and plumbing work begins.

OCTOBER 2018

The steel skeleton frame of the building is erected.

NOVEMBER 2018

Masonry work begins and exterior walls are erected.

DECEMBER 2018

Roof and walls are completed.

JANUARY–MARCH 2019

Interior work begins—including mechanical, electrical, plumbing and fire-protection systems.

JUNE–JULY 2019

Interior finishing work takes place, including paint, tile and scoreboards.

FALL 2019

John D. Norcross ’54 Aquatic Center grand opening and dedication
